The Walking Session Podcast The Walking Session is the official podcast of WalkandTalkTherapy.com, exploring the psychology behind movement, mental health and human performance. Hosted by psychologist Maz Miller, each episode is designed to be listened to while you walk. Together we’ll explore why movement changes the way we think, feel and cope, drawing on psychological science, clinical experience and practical reflection. Some episodes explore anxiety, burnout, confidence, grief, perfectionism and relationships. Others dive into sport psychology, behaviour change, resilience, nature, performance and the growing evidence behind walk and talk therapy. This isn’t therapy, and it isn’t a replacement for professional support. It’s psychology made practical, one conversation at a time. Whether you’re walking around the block, along the beach, through the bush or between meetings, each episode is an invitation to slow down, reflect and discover how movement can support a healthier mind. Because sometimes the best conversations don’t happen sitting still. They happen one step at a time.
